TORCH agents in pregnant Saudi women
Hani O Ghazi1, Abdulwahab M Telmesani, Mahomed F Mahomed
1Department of Microbiology, Faculty of Medicine and Medical Sciences, Umm Al-Qura University, Makkah, Kingdom of Saudi Arabia. hanighazi@hotmail.com
Objective:
To determine the seroprevalence rates of IgG to common TORCH agents in pregnant Saudi women using indirect enzyme-linked immunosorbent assay.
Subjects And Methods:
A total of 926 samples of sera were tested for antibodies to TORCH agents known to cause serious congenital infections: Toxoplasma gondii, rubella, cytomegalovirus (CMV), herpes simplex viruses (HSV-1 and HSV-2), varicella zoster virus (VZV) and human immunodeficiency virus (HIV-1 and HIV-2).
Results:
Toxoplasma IgG antibodies were detected in 35.6%, CMV total IgG antibodies were found in 92.1%, rubella IgG antibodies in 93.3%, HSV-1 IgG antibodies in 90.9%, HSV-2 IgG in 27.1%, and VZV IgG antibodies in 74.4%. A 0% seroprevalence rate for HIV-1 and -2 was found.
Conclusion:
Pregnant Saudi women commonly have IgG antibodies to rubella, CMV, HSV-1 and -2, VZV, and T. gondii. Serological evidence of HIV infection was not observed.
